Ingredients for Olive Oil Marinated Mozzarella

Gather these items:

  • 1 cup Bertolli extra virgin olive oil
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up fresh basil,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on fresh thyme
  • 1 tablespoon fresh oregano
  • 1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es
  • 1 teaspoon kosher salt
  • 16 ounces Bocconcini or ciliegine mozzarella

How to Make Olive Oil Marinated Mozzarella Step-by-Step

  1. Step 1: Combine the olive oil, minced garlic, fresh basil, thyme, oregano, red pepper flakes, and kosher salt in a mixing bowl. Mix well until all ingredients are evenly blended and fragrant.
  2. Step 2: Add the drained bocconcini or ciliegine mozzarella balls to the bowl with the marinade. Gently stir them until each ball is completely coated.
  3. Step 3: Marinate the mozzarella balls for at least one hour, or longer if time allows.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to five days.

How to Store and Reheat Olive Oil Marinated Mozzarella

To store your Olive Oil Marinated Mozzarella, keep it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. The marinated mozzarella will last for up to five days, making it ideal for meal prep. Simply take it out when ready to enjoy and allow it to come to room temperature for the best flavor.

How do I avoid common mistakes with Olive Oil Marinated Mozzarella?

Ensure that the mozzarella is well-drained before marinating to prevent excess moisture. Additionally, don’t skip the marination time, as this is crucial for developing flavor. Finally, always taste and adjust the seasoning to your preference.
